Yes: Warts are caused by a skin virus. These viruses can be transmitted from any warty area to any other area that has even the slightest break in the skin. Rubbing of skin can cause microabrasions where virus can enter. Finger warts are easily treated with over the counter medications containing salicylic acid. If you have a wart on your nipple/breast, it may need to be treated by a dr.
